Transaction 581c28da35a2856246eaceee18652cfc5fa5de36c73539addc3f60d014edba61
1 Input
1 Output
-
581c28da35a2856246eaceee18652cfc5fa5de36c73539addc3f60d014edba61:0
- value
- 362176
- script pubkey
- OP_0 OP_PUSHBYTES_20 139b4daac9f60d155164dea05dd6617931d6919c
- address
- bc1qzwd5m2kf7cx325tym6s9m4np0ycadyvuc4e7ju